87 TII dyno runs 450whp!

so i made a trip to the dyno today to test out my new turbo setup, which included a new long runner manifold, 3.5 inch downpipe from Turblown, and T04Z turbo with 1.15 AR. the rest of the mods on the car are..

stock internals brand new S5 motor
supra TT pump
aeromotive FPR
parallel AN fuel system W/ KG rails
850cc prim 1600cc sec
greddy FMIC
custom 4 inch cold air intake
microtech LT10s
coolingmist trunkmount kit
ECT ECT


so my old setup was a greddy cast manifold, 3 inch downpipe and T04R turbo.. i made 380WHP with that setup at 15psi, with the new turbo setup i made 411WHP at 15psi, then we did a high boost run 18psi with methenol injection, we made 450WHP and decided to stop there due to the motor being stock, the tuner was concerned with the motor not being dowl pinned/studded, he said the motor would be likely to flex and start braking irons, he said on the street this would never happen but on the dyno it was likely because it puts so much more stress on the motor. Your tuner is right.. I cracked my front plate on the dyno the 1st go around so I had it pinned.
here is my setup just for clarification.

S4 motor with 440HP at 13lbs of boost ( in an 85 GSL-SE 1st gen)
streetported running on 93 pump gas
T-70 with an 84 hot side and an HKS manifold.
Aeromotive A1000 fuel pump
720/1600cc injectors
NPR fmic
Microtech lt-8

thanks for the comments everyone! ill answer some questions now...first off yes the meth made a big difference, intake manifold felt like ice after a dyno pull..this motor is bone stock internals, no porting at all, i was running 93 pump gas and 50/50 meth water, and i think my injector duty was 40% at 15psi and 65% at 18psi...im not 100% sure though. i knew i had plenty of fuel so i wasn't to concerned with keeping track of the duty cycle. sorry the colors didnt show up well, this is the first time ive ever scanned something believe it or not lol also i am in the process of building a new motor by myself, its going to have race ported secondary ports and street port primaries. then im using rx8 e shaft and the stronger casting irons, new rotor housings, 3mm cryo treated apex seals, dowl pinned/studded, my goal for this new motor is 600whp, its going to be a long build though so it probably wont be done until next summer, the new restoration/turbo setup has drained my funds and im in the process of looking for a house so the 7 is now on the back burner for a while..
